NUR 401 - Transcultural Concepts Nursing

Institution:
Coastal Carolina University
Subject:
Nursing
Description:
(3 credits)(Restricted to students in the Nursing program) This course is designed to introduce students to transcultural nursing in health care today. Different cultural health and healing practices will be explored. Students will examine their own cultural health practices and compare these healing practices to other culture groups. Students will examine various ways in which transcultural nursing facilitates nurses' knowledge and skill in communicating with and caring for people from diverse cultures. This course may be repeated. Offered as needed
